Router is Netgear\DG834GT. MacBook and IBM ThinkPad both work perfectly with it, whether via ethernet or W/s. However, this Toshiba Portege 4000 works only via ethernet. All my network-adapters are shown in Device Mgr as working. I have no red Xs or yellow ?s or !s. The w/s switch at the front of the PC is at On.

Here is what I get from IPCONFIG/ALL
